Harrison Nuclear Power Plant is a power plant in the Generation 1 continuity family.

The Harrison Nuclear Power Plant is a nuclear plant in Oregon that, once completed, will have a power output far exceeding any other.

Fiction

Marvel Comics continuity

While the Harrison Nuclear Power Plant was still under construction in 1984, the Decepticons sent Ravage to research its fuel potential. After overhearing engineer Jason Boyd talking about the plant's capabilities, Ravage reported to Megatron, who ordered his troops to attack. The Decepticons scattered the workers and hauled away bits and pieces of the power plant, which they used to construct Fortress Sinister. Power Play!
